虫または無邪気なおせっかい

 リモート見学のコースウェアのうち、社外向けの分をOEMしていたのを金曜日に出荷したら、土曜日の早朝3時にお返事が来て、さすが独立行政ホージンのプロフェッショナリズムは違うなぁと感心しながら、データの組込み作業を終えて5時にメール添付で納品したつもりになっていた。
 ところが、PDF文書の中でリンク切れが多発しているとのお返事が来て、調べてみるとPower*ointで「別名で保存」でPDF化した文書の、リンクの中の「?」が全部「%3F」にエンコードされていることに気がついた。
 すなわち、Power*oint上ではYoutubeビデオに飛ぶリンク(http://www.youtube.com/watch?=ビデオ番号)が、PDFにした途端http://www.youtube.com/watch%3F=ビデオ番号に変換されて、404 NOT FOUNDエラーになるのである。
 ペーストしただけで勝手に「ハイパーリンクに変更する」ような無邪気なおせっかいがエスカレートして、遂に勝手に「危険な場所にリンクされないためにエンコードしてしまう」に到達してしまったのかどうかははっきりわからないが、少なくとも設定メニューから解除できるオプションではない。これをバグと呼ぶべきと主張したいが、どうだろうか。
 いずれにしても、「?」を使わない記法(http://youtu.be/ビデオ番号)でURLを書き直すのをスマートな回避策としてお勧めしておくことにする。

本ブログではamazon associate広告を利用しています。